Choosing the Right Daycare for Your Household



Discovering the right day care for your household can feel overwhelming, specifically with numerous options readily available. Beginning by recognizing your top priorities-- location, price, and details programs that fit your youngster's demands.

See potential day care facilities to obtain a feel for their environment, cleanliness, and general atmosphere. Check for required licenses and accreditations to make certain quality treatment. Speak to other parents for their suggestions and experiences.

Finally, trust your impulses-- if a location really feels right, it likely is. With detailed research study and factor to consider, you'll locate a childcare that lines up with your family's values and requirements, giving satisfaction while you stabilize work and life.

Tips for Preserving Work-Life Balance While Utilizing Day Care



Although juggling work and parenting can be challenging, utilizing day care properly can assist you maintain a healthy work-life equilibrium.

First, set clear limits in between work and home life. When you go to work, focus on your tasks, and when you're with your kid, be totally present. Make use of the day care hours to obtain your work done efficiently, preventing diversions.

Don't forget to communicate with your childcare provider; remain informed concerning your child's day to assist you feel attached. Arrange regular check-ins with your companion to go over parenting responsibilities and share updates.

Finally, prioritize self-care. Whether it's a fast workout or some silent reading time, looking after on your own ensures you're a lot more stimulated and engaged both at the workplace and home.
